>> 1. Today there have been changes made to Qt Creator that require very
>> recent Qt 4.6 sources to compile. So whoever builds Creator from sources
>> will most likely have to compile Qt first.
>>
>> The change affects only the building of Creator itself, not applications
>> built with Qt Creator. It's still possible to use Qt 4.5 or even older
>> for them.
